Sensex down 157 points at 11,589

April 07, 2006

The markets plunged after hitting a new high of 11,931 on Friday.

The Sensex crashed by nearly 366 points in intra-day trade to as low as 10,565, owing to rumours that Sebi had banned 11 foreign institutional investors.

However, it recovered losses after Sebi denied the news.

The Sensex finally closed at 11,589, down 157 points.

The Nifty lost 56 points to close at 3,455.
